When a creator's private or paywalled content is leaked, the professional ramifications are swift and multifaceted. For an influencer building a brand, a leak is not just a privacy violation; it is a direct threat to their business model. 1. The Financial Blow

Many modern creators rely on a tiered content system. They offer free content on platforms like TikTok and Instagram to build a top-of-funnel audience, and reserve exclusive, high-value content for paying subscribers. When that exclusive content is leaked for free, it devalues the product. Why would a casual fan pay for a subscription when a simple Google search yields the same content? 2. Brand Partnerships and Sponsorships

The lifeblood of many influencers is corporate sponsorships. Brands are notoriously risk-averse. If a creator becomes associated with "leaks" or illicitly distributed adult/private content, brands may quickly distance themselves to protect their corporate image. Morality clauses in influencer contracts often allow brands to terminate partnerships immediately if a creator is involved in a public scandal. 3. Mental Health and Emotional Toll

Beyond the business metrics lies the human element. Having private photos, videos, or messages broadcast to millions of strangers without consent is a profound violation of privacy. Many creators report experiencing severe anxiety, depression, and burnout following a major leak, sometimes leading them to take extended hiatuses or delete their accounts entirely. Crisis Management: How Creators Fight Back

When faced with a crisis like leaked content, creators typically have to choose between a few different strategies to salvage their careers. The Legal Route (DMCA Takedowns)

Creators own the copyright to their images and videos. Many employ specialized digital management agencies that aggressively issue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A) takedown notices to search engines and file-sharing sites to wipe the leaked content from the web. Flipping the Narrative
